我有一个布局选项卡,我可以在其中添加和删除选项卡,当我创建一个新选项卡时,我想向它添加一个新的ACE编辑器(http://ace.ajax.org/)(i'm使用jqueryui选项卡)但是这样不起作用:$(function(){var$tab_title_input=$("#tab_title"),$tab_content_input=$("#tab_content");vartab_counter=3;//tabsinitwithacustomtabtemplateandan"add"callbackfillinginthecontentvar$tabs=$("#tabs").ta
我正在构建一个严重依赖svg的网络应用程序。作为引用,我正在使用raphaeljs库来处理所有这些。在这种特殊情况下,我实现了一些模仿滚动条并在屏幕上移动一堆svg功能(约500个元素)的东西。这些功能的一部分是(~100)个元素。其他元素包括,和元素。因此,我注意到我的应用程序在我的笔记本电脑上并不是非常活泼,而且由于速度原因在ipad上处理起来非常烦人。但是,只要在滚动过程中删除或忽略文本元素,它就会立即达到不错的速度。我尝试做一些速度测试(非常粗略的测试,使用newDate().getTime())并发现移动所有元素需要大约10毫秒,除了。元素,但是当时需要~120毫秒包括元素。
这是我当前为我的表单设置的验证Thissearchfieldisrequired.和我的表格它工作正常。但这是我不喜欢这种情况的地方1)在空的搜索框上按Enter->它显示正确的消息“需要字段”2)开始键入和删除文本而不按回车->它再次显示错误消息这是我不想要的第二种情况...有什么想法吗? 最佳答案 也许您的错误消息字段名称不正确。由于您没有提供示例,因此无法说出您无法正常工作的确切原因。但是,当我测试时,它工作正常。Thissearchfieldisrequired.http://plnkr.co/edit/56koY7YxPD
我正在做的是创建一个简单的html页面,其中有一个文本框。用户向该文本框发布一些输入,例如firstlastfirstlastfirstlastfirstlast假设这些是不同的名称。我想做的是在文本框中输入,并将其显示到屏幕上,并按字母顺序删除重复的名称,并在它们周围添加选项标签。我有什么PasteCodeHere:$(document).ready(function(){$('#content').change(function(){vartest=$('#content').val();$("#contentdisplay").html(test);});});现在,当用户在文本
关于这个还有另外两个主题,但它们对我没有帮助。我有这个html:AllARCHITECTUREBuildingCONSTRUCTIONDESIGNPaintingConstructionConstructionConstructionConstructionConstructionConstruction和JS同位素代码://*IsotopeJsfunctionportfolio_isotope(){if($('.portfolio_item,.portfolio_2.portfolio_filterulli').length){//Activateisotopeincontainer
通过传统表格输入我的地址让我抓狂:既然可以从我的邮政编码推断出我的城市和州,为什么我必须输入我的城市、州、和邮政编码?从下拉列表中选择您的状态是一件很痛苦的事情——通常您不能进入它,您必须使用鼠标等等。alttexthttp://img10.imageshack.us/img10/7404/traditionaladdressform.png因为我觉得这个过程非常令人反感,所以当我设计我的在线商店(bombsheets.com)时,我决定为地址构建一个自动完成小部件。在您输入时,我们会尝试对您的地址进行地理编码(通过Googlemap):alttexthttp://img403.ima
在一个页面中我有一个链接;单击它会打开一个对话框并为该对话框设置一个文本框值。但是,一旦我在该对话框中单击提交,文本框值为空。链接:脚本:jQuery(document).ready(function(){jQuery("#openiddialog").dialog({autoOpen:false,width:600,modal:true,buttons:{"Cancel":function(){$(this).dialog("close");}}});});functionexpand(obj){$("#").val(obj);}对话框: 最佳答案
我正在寻找一种方法来将所有文本收集到一个jQuery包装集中,但我需要在没有文本节点的兄弟节点之间创建空间。例如,考虑这个HTML:Listitem#1.Listitem#2.Listitem#3.如果我只是使用jQuery的text()收集文本内容的方法,像这样:var$div=$('div'),text=$div.text().trim();alert(text);产生以下文本:Listitem#1.Listitem#2.Listitem#3.因为每个之间没有空格元素。我实际上要寻找的是这个(注意每个句子之间的单个空格):Listitem#1.Listitem#3.Listitem
我需要一个Jquery脚本来逐行chop文本段落(而不是按字符数)。我想实现一个均匀chop的文本block。它应该有一个“更多”和“更少”的链接来扩展和缩短文本段落。我的文本段落包裹在一个带有类的div中,如下所示:HeadlineTheparagraphTexthere我在SOF上找到的最接近的解决方案是下面的一个(但它适用于textarea元素,对我不起作用):Limitingnumberoflinesintextarea非常感谢任何提示。本 最佳答案 对于基本方法,您可以查看line-heightCSS属性并在计算中使用它。
我的应用程序所有者希望选择的文本字段为大写,就像打开大写锁定一样。我正在为这些字段使用带有可观察对象的KnockoutJSView模型。有没有一种方法可以有效地将任何用户输入的文本转换为大写?我在我想更改的控件上放置了一个input事件,但发现虽然它有效,但observables没有更新。toUpper:function(d,e){if(e.target){if(e.target.value){e.target.value=e.target.value.toUpperCase();}}}我也一直在考虑将ucaseCSS类放在我想要大写的控件上,然后在客户端或服务器上,将这些字段保存为大